A transitive verb phrase is a phrase that combines a verb with a preposition or other particle and requires a direct object (e.g., take out the trash.).
transitive verb phrase
a. to cheer
La multitud le lanzó vítores al famoso astronauta durante el desfile.The crowd cheered the famous astronaut during the parade.
An intransitive verb phrase is a phrase that combines a verb with a preposition or other particle and does not require a direct object (e.g., Everybody please stand up.).
intransitive verb phrase
a. to cheer
El público en el estadio lanzó vítores cuando el equipo local anotó un gol.The crowd at the stadium cheered when the local team scored.
